Performance
The Motorola Edge (2022) boasts the MediaTek Dimensity 1050, fabricated on a 6nm process, compared to the REVVL V+ 5G’s Dimensity 700 on a 7nm node. This translates to a significant performance advantage for the Edge. The Dimensity 1050’s Cortex-A78 cores, clocked at 2.5 GHz, are more powerful than the REVVL V+ 5G’s Cortex-A76 cores at 2.2 GHz. This difference will be most noticeable in demanding tasks like gaming and video editing. The 6nm process also contributes to better thermal efficiency, potentially reducing throttling during sustained workloads.
Battery Life
The REVVL V+ 5G supports 18W wired charging, while the Motorola Edge (2022) offers a more versatile charging solution with 30W wired, 15W wireless, and 5W reverse wired charging. This means the Edge can be fully charged significantly faster and offers the convenience of wireless charging.
